1986 Alfa Romeo 75 vs. 1962 Fiat 2300

To start off, 1986 Alfa Romeo 75 is newer by 24 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1962 Fiat 2300.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1962 Fiat 2300 would be higher. At 2,393 cc (6 cylinders), 1986 Alfa Romeo 75 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1986 Alfa Romeo 75 (153 HP @ 5500 RPM) has 49 more horse power than 1962 Fiat 2300. (104 HP @ 5300 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 1986 Alfa Romeo 75 should accelerate faster than 1962 Fiat 2300.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1962 Fiat 2300 weights approximately 150 kg more than 1986 Alfa Romeo 75.

Both vehicles are rear wheel drive (RWD) - it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, both vehicles do the job better than front w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1986 Alfa Romeo 75 (206 Nm @ 3200 RPM) has 39 more torque (in Nm) than 1962 Fiat 2300. (167 Nm @ 2800 RPM). This means 1986 Alfa Romeo 75 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1962 Fiat 2300.

Compare all specifications:

1986 Alfa Romeo 75 1962 Fiat 2300
Make Alfa Romeo Fiat
Model 75 2300
Year Released 1986 1962
Body Type Sedan Coupe
Engine Position Front Front
Engine Size 2393 cc 2279 cc
Engine Cylinders 6 cylinders 6 cylinders
Engine Type V in-line
Horse Power 153 HP 104 HP
Engine RPM 5500 RPM 5300 RPM
Torque 206 Nm 167 Nm
Torque RPM 3200 RPM 2800 RPM
Engine Compression Ratio 9.0:1 8.8:1
Drive Type Rear Rear
Transmission Type Manual Manual
Number of Seats 5 seats 4 seats
Number of Doors 4 doors 2 doors
Vehicle Weight 1160 kg 1310 kg
Vehicle Length 4340 mm 4630 mm
Vehicle Width 1640 mm 1640 mm
Vehicle Height 1360 mm 1370 mm
Wheelbase Size 2460 mm 2660 mm
Fuel Tank Capacity 68 L 70 L
